Bug#835734: kido: FTBFS: FCLCollisionNode.cpp:354:5: error: 'boost' has not been declared

Lucas Nussbaum lucas at debian.org
Sun Aug 28 09:13:42 UTC 2016


Source: kido
Version: 0.1.0+dfsg-1
Severity: serious
Tags: stretch sid
User: debian-qa at lists.debian.org
Usertags: qa-ftbfs-20160828 qa-ftbfs
Justification: FTBFS on amd64

Hi,

During a rebuild of all packages in sid, your package failed to build on
amd64.

Relevant part (hopefully):
> cd /<<BUILDDIR>>/kido-0.1.0+dfsg/build/kido && /usr/bin/c++   -DBOOST_TEST_DYN_LINK -DHAVE_BULLET_COLLISION -Dkido_EXPORTS -I/<<BUILDDIR>>/kido-0.1.0+dfsg -isystem /usr/include/eigen3 -isystem /usr/include/bullet -I/<<BUILDDIR>>/kido-0.1.0+dfsg/build  -Wall -msse2 -fPIC -std=c++11 -g -O2 -fdebug-prefix-map=/<<BUILDDIR>>/kido-0.1.0+dfsg=. -fPIE -fstack-protector-strong -Wformat -Werror=format-security -Wdate-time -D_FORTIFY_SOURCE=2 -fPIC   -I/usr/include/bullet -o CMakeFiles/kido.dir/collision/fcl/FCLCollisionNode.cpp.o -c /<<BUILDDIR>>/kido-0.1.0+dfsg/kido/collision/fcl/FCLCollisionNode.cpp
> /<<BUILDDIR>>/kido-0.1.0+dfsg/kido/collision/fcl/FCLCollisionNode.cpp: In constructor 'kido::collision::FCLCollisionNode::FCLCollisionNode(kido::dynamics::BodyNode*)':
> /<<BUILDDIR>>/kido-0.1.0+dfsg/kido/collision/fcl/FCLCollisionNode.cpp:354:5: error: 'boost' has not been declared
>      boost::shared_ptr<fcl::CollisionGeometry> fclCollGeom;
>      ^~~~~
> /<<BUILDDIR>>/kido-0.1.0+dfsg/kido/collision/fcl/FCLCollisionNode.cpp:354:45: error: expected primary-expression before '>' token
>      boost::shared_ptr<fcl::CollisionGeometry> fclCollGeom;
>                                              ^
> /<<BUILDDIR>>/kido-0.1.0+dfsg/kido/collision/fcl/FCLCollisionNode.cpp:354:47: error: 'fclCollGeom' was not declared in this scope
>      boost::shared_ptr<fcl::CollisionGeometry> fclCollGeom;
>                                                ^~~~~~~~~~~
> kido/CMakeFiles/kido.dir/build.make:1937: recipe for target 'kido/CMakeFiles/kido.dir/collision/fcl/FCLCollisionNode.cpp.o' failed
> make[4]: *** [kido/CMakeFiles/kido.dir/collision/fcl/FCLCollisionNode.cpp.o] Error 1

The full build log is available from:
   http://people.debian.org/~lucas/logs/2016/08/28/kido_0.1.0+dfsg-1_unstable.log

A list of current common problems and possible solutions is available at
http://wiki.debian.org/qa.debian.org/FTBFS . You're welcome to contribute!

About the archive rebuild: The rebuild was done on EC2 VM instances from
Amazon Web Services, using a clean, minimal and up-to-date chroot. Every
failed build was retried once to eliminate random failures.



More information about the debian-science-maintainers mailing list